Handover: Timetable Solver (Project Slatewing)

Mira, before you review: the solver runs as a sandboxed worker with no outbound network access, and all constraint files are validated against the Slatewing schema before ingestion. Audit logging covers every schedule mutation, retained 90 days. Secrets are injected at deploy time only. Full threat-model notes and the permission matrix live on the internal review page.

wiki page, tahaf-tajog: https://jira.ordindyn.corp/pipeline

- [ ] **Step 7: Seal the plugin-signing key for GraphScope.** Before external plugin authors can publish visualizer extensions, the signing key generated in Step 5 must be sealed in the ceremony vault. Confirm both witnesses from the Ferndale ops rotation are present and have initialed the ledger. Once the vault prompt appears, the presiding engineer enters the recovery passphrase, which is recorded on the line immediately below this item.

recovery phrase for bafof-kajof: quenmir-ralmir-praeth

## Flaky integration tests — Ledgerpin payments service

Symptom: intermittent 401s in the settlement suite. Cause: shared sandbox credentials expiring mid-run. Fix: tests now mint short-lived tokens per suite; do not reuse tokens across parallel shards. If you see retries masking auth failures, check the harness logs first. For manual reproduction against the Ledgerpin sandbox, authenticate with the token below.

session JWT of yawep-yawep = eyJhbGciOiJIUzI1NiIsInR5cCI6IkpXVCJ9.eyJzdWIiOiI3pWF3_In0.aXYsHiog